Another TMR tip:

Some people are finding that the DMR will not function when shooting continuous mode with the R8. In some cases the DMR seems to be off completely yet the camera can take pictures. One of the main causes f this little problem is the firmware version on the R8. Leica will need to update the software on the actual R8 for it to work seemlesly with the DMR. This is common with older R8's.

I had that happen to me once (DMR shut off, but I could still take pictures). The DMR completely locked up ... it wouldn't even turn off automatically or manually. I had to remove the battery (even though the instructions say not to when the unit is on) ... it proved to be the only way of turning it off.

I have since installed the firmware upgrade and it has not happened since.

The firmware update has to made by Leica. I had mine done, it was free of charge. I sent in my R8+DMR but it was away for a month.
You cannot go by the serial number to know whether it has to be updated.
